Favorite Spaghetti Sauce
- 1 1/2 lb. Italian sausage
- 1/2 lb. ground round
- onion, chopped
- chopped green pepper
- 1 tsp. oregano leaf and/or sweet basil
- 2 Tbsp. parsley
- 1/2 tsp. Italian seasoning
- 1 Tbsp. brown sugar or less (adjust to your taste)
- salt and pepper to taste
- 2 to 3 large cans tomato sauce (can also add Italian tomato sauce if desired)
- 1 to 2 Tbsp. oil
- Brown meat in oil with onion and green pepper.
- Drain off any grease (can use all Italian sausage if desired).
- Add seasonings and cook briefly until it flavors the meat.
- Add tomato sauce (adjust to own desired thickness, rinse cans with little water and add to sauce).
- When heated through and boiling, add brown sugar to taste.
- Adjust seasonings if necessary.
- Cook on low for 1 to 2 hours.
- Serve over spaghetti or use as sauce for lasagna.
- Freezes well.
